If Madi deposits $40 more in her bank account this week, she'll then have $162.

How much money does he have to start out with this week?
Choose the equation that correctly models this situation.

m + 162 = 40

40m = 162

m - 40 = 162

m + 40 = 162

Answer:

M + 40 = 162

Explanation:

if M is the original amount of money Madi has and she adds 40, Then she would have 162.
